Property Renovation Loans:Financing:Options & Requirements

Securing financing for a property renovation project can feel challenging, but several financing options are available. Traditional bank loans are a typical route, often requiring substantial equity and a solid business plan. SBA credit lines also offer attractive rates, especially for small businesses. Hard money credit provide a faster path to money, though usually at a higher interest percentage. Construction credit are designed specifically for projects involving extensive building improvements. Requirements generally include a detailed scope of work, accurate cost estimates, a sustainable business model, and a thorough assessment of the property's value. Lenders will also scrutinize your credit history and obligations to ensure financial stability.

Determining Commercial Refurbishment Costs Per Area

Figuring out the projected cost of a commercial upgrade can feel overwhelming, especially when considering expenses per area. While a precise number is difficult to nail down upfront, understanding the broad ranges helps with forecasting. These costs are influenced by a variety of factors, including the nature of the work—whether it's a cosmetic refresh or a full-scale transformation. Besides, material selection, labor fees, and the region all play a significant role. Simple improvements like painting and flooring typically fall on the lower end of the range, while structural alterations or adding extra systems will drastically increase the price per foot. It's advisable to obtain multiple estimates from qualified contractors to get a more accurate assessment of potential renovation costs.

Selecting a Retail Renovation Firm Selection Checklist

Securing the right skilled commercial renovation company is crucial for a successful project outcome. Don't rush the process; a thorough choice checklist is your best defense. First, rigorously check licenses and insurance – are they current and adequate for the scope of projects? Next, request and meticulously review references, directly contacting previous clients to gauge their pleasure. Assess the company’s portfolio – does their past projects align with your vision and desired aesthetic? Secure multiple quotes and compare them not only on price, but also on the detailed scope of tasks included and the proposed duration. Finally, don’s overlook the importance of a clear and comprehensive agreement, outlining all responsibilities and remittance terms – this is your safeguard against future disputes.
